Actions for Emergency Door Repair
If a door emergency arises, property owners or entrepreneur ought to take immediate action. Here are some essential steps for reliable emergency door repair:
Assess the Damage:
Evaluate the extent of the damage. Is it cosmetic, or does it prevent functionality? Note any broken locks, hinges, or frames.
Secure the Area:
If it's a break-in or damage is comprehensive, consider momentarily boarding up the door to prevent extra entry.
Repair or Replace Locks:
For broken locks, check if they can simply be fixed. If not, consider replacing with a quality locking system.
Fix Hinges:
Check the screws of the hinges for tightness. Change broken hinges with new ones that can withstand stress.
Address Misalignment:
If the door is misaligned, change the hinges or frame to make sure an appropriate fit. This might involve tightening screws or utilizing shims for alignment.
Repair Weather Damage:
For doors affected by weather condition, consider refinishing or sealing them to avoid future damage.
Replace Damaged Glass:
If glass panels are shattered, change them as soon as possible. Use shatterproof glass for security and durability.
Call a Professional (If Needed):

Avoiding door damage can conserve important time and resources. Below are some maintenance tips to lengthen the lifespan of doors and decrease emergencies:
Regular Inspections: Check door frames, locks, and hinges frequently for signs of wear or damage.Wetness Control: Keep doors dry and tidy.
